Currently PTP only supports running applications on Linux and MacOSX platforms, though it may be possible to run applications on Windows if your environment was Cygwin based. This has never been tested though, so I don't know if it would work.

1) When I try to start my MPICH2 resource manager I get the following error message:
Command failed.
  Failed to create remote process for MPICH2 discover command.
  Cannot run program "C:/MPICH2/bin/mpdtrace": Launching failed

I have made an MPI-project and I am able to run it trough command prompt.

Now I'm trying to use PTP for the first time. First I tried to configure a MPICH2 local resource manager in PTP Runtime perspective.

MPICH2 connection configuration:
Remote service provider: local
Remote location: local
Multiplexing options: none, localhost
like the guide adviced. ( guide: http://www.eclipse.org/ptp/documentation/2.1/org.eclipse.ptp.help/html/02resMgrSetup.html )

MPICH2 tool configuration:
I selected: use default settings
Path to installation: I tried giving /MPICH2/bin and also empty

Default names.

2) Well after a while I ignored  it, since the resource manager icon showed green anyway, and tried to create parallel launch configuration for my project.

I returned to C perspecitve and opened the run configurations window and cerated a new parallel configuration.
My resource manager was available so I selected it and set the number of processes and searched my executable from the project directory.
Then I selected SDM as the debugger but I could'nt set the path to debugger executable.
The guide I was reading says that the sdm.exe should be in eclipse's plugins/org.eclipse.ptp.os.arch_version/bin where os.arch_version is operating system, architecture and version.
( guide: http://www.eclipse.org/ptp/documentation/2.1/org.eclipse.ptp.help/html/03pLaunchConfig.html )
Problem is that none of the directorys named that way contain the directory "bin". Also I only found directorys for aix,linux and macos but what about windows?

I installed PTP and CDT trough eclipse's software updates and it went well.

Eclipse version: 3.4.2
CDT version: 5.0.2
PTP version: 2.1.2
SDM version: 2.1.2
Windows xp 32bit
